Output 6580e228acf87a5e2f4634b0305b99883a93fcadbd6bf69878b621709698c68d: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 496b9021d6092fcfd1b4e069bde4ed529d205516 OP_EQUAL
address
38PE7A3cyDoa9s1rFCbTAnaau1Zxgt1kXH
transaction
6580e228acf87a5e2f4634b0305b99883a93fcadbd6bf69878b621709698c68d
spent
true